Transaction a20620ffb39f29169caab2c24192ba70139c05f008efb7a2985d1e9bef2281be
2 Input
2 Outputs
- a20620ffb39f29169caab2c24192ba70139c05f008efb7a2985d1e9bef2281be:0
- a20620ffb39f29169caab2c24192ba70139c05f008efb7a2985d1e9bef2281be:1
value 1301236174
address 19JptVWs21vy55JZGnaFKxET4fkpQjSonC
value 38616040
address 17p3qDPSdoV6MTe5eP1wHvqrRWTXTKjMuJ